#ae7212 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ae7212 is composed of 68.2% red, 44.7%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ae7212 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e424 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#ae7212 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ae7212 has RGB values of R:174, G:114,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.9,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11432466.

Shades and Tints of #ae7212

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ae7212

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64615c is the less saturated color, while #bd7503 is the most saturated one.
